How many horsepower does a Cummins motorhome have?

With engines rated from 300 hp to more than 605 hp, Cummins offers power and reliability for every type of motorhome on the market. X15 The most popular heavy-duty engine in North America, the X15 is capable of powering premium motorhomes of any size with up to 605 hp and 1950 lb-ft of peak torque.

Are there any problems with the 8.3 Cummins Engine?

The 8.3 CAPS is electronically driven and runs into many of the same problems as on the 5.9 Cummins. These include failures with the lift pump, trouble due to excess water in diesel fuel, and excess heat. All of these may cause failures or faults with the 8.3 Cummins CAPS. The CAPS issue mainly affects motorhomes and other on road engines.

How many horsepower does a Cummins L9 engine have?

The XPI fuel system enables quiet, responsive operation while replaceable wet liners, roller followers, bypass oil filtration and targeted-piston cooling result in extended life and higher resale value. The L9 has ratings ranging from 330-450 hp with up to 1250 lb-ft of peak torque.

What kind of engine does a Ford 7000 have?

The 7000 and 8000 series had a Caterpillar V175 standard, the 7000 had a V200 and the 8000 had a V225 available. The 9000 series had a Cummins NH230 standard, Cummins N series up to 350 hp (260 kW) and Caterpillar 3406 series up to 375 hp (280 kW) were optional. 1973 engines (not all are shown.) Cat. V175 Cat.
